What is a Wallet Address for Virtual Currency Withdrawal?

In the realm of cryptocurrency, a wallet address serves as a unique identifier for an individual's digital wallet, analogous to an account number in traditional banking. It represents a destination or endpoint where cryptocurrencies can be sent or received.

Format and Types of Wallet Addresses

Wallet addresses can vary in format depending on the specific cryptocurrency used. Some common formats include:

Bitcoin (BTC): Begins with "1" or "3"Ethereum (ETH): 'hexadecimal string prefixed with "0x"Litecoin (LTC): Starts with "L"Dogecoin (DOGE): Commences with "D"

Purpose of Withdrawal Wallet Addresses

Withdrawal wallet addresses are primarily utilized for transferring funds out of cryptocurrency exchanges or other platforms. When you initiate a withdrawal from an exchange, you will be prompted to provide the recipient's withdrawal address, which is typically yours or another wallet you control.

Locating the Withdrawal Wallet Address in Exchanges

Every cryptocurrency exchange features a dedicated section or page for users to withdraw their funds. Here's a general overview of how to locate the withdrawal address in popular exchanges:

  1. Binance: Navigate to "Funds" > "Withdraw" > Select the cryptocurrency > Enter the recipient's withdrawal address.
  2. Coinbase: Go to "Accounts" > "Withdraw" > Choose the asset > Input the recipient's withdrawal address.
  3. Kraken: Visit "Funding" > "Withdraw" > Pick the cryptocurrency > Enter the recipient's withdrawal address.
Verifying the Correctness of the Withdrawal Address

Before confirming a withdrawal, it is imperative to meticulously verify the accuracy of the recipient's withdrawal address. even a single mistyped character can result in the permanent loss of your funds.

  • Double-Check and Precautions: Re-enter and double-check the withdrawal address multiple times to avoid errors.
  • Using Blockchain Explorers: Utilize blockchain explorers to cross-verify the address. Blockchain explorers are websites or tools that allow you to search and validate cryptocurrency transactions and addresses. By inputting the recipient's withdrawal address into a blockchain explorer, you can confirm its validity and ownership.
Steps for Withdrawing Cryptocurrency Using a Withdrawal Address
  1. Enter the Address and Amount: Access the withdrawal section of your exchange or platform. Enter the recipient's withdrawal address along with the amount of cryptocurrency you wish to withdraw.
  2. Verify Again and Confirm the Withdrawal: Thoroughly review the details of the withdrawal, including the amount, recipient's address, and network fees (if applicable). Click confirm to initiate the withdrawal process.
